BalancedINFO:Giuseppe Materazzi − father of World Cup winner Marco − was a midfielder who played mostly for Lecce and always in Serie C: 228 matches and 17 goals from 1968 to 1975. He's the club longest serving captain. He played also for Reggina and Bari. His main position was right-half but he was used most times as inside at Lecce.
Materazzi was a player able to set up the action in an excellent way and he was the one who had to preserve the order in the midfield. He was dynamic, had athletic power and his playstyle was mainly based on a good tactical intelligence. He was effective in attack as well, considering his decent number of goals. At Bari he played also as side midfielder to take advantage of his crosses.
